i was in my third year of graduate school when i found out that i was pregnant. i had been on various forms of birth control since i was a teenager, and unfortunately it failed at a difficult time in my life. i was struggling with anxiety disorder and was not ready to become a mother while still a student. my partner (now my husband) and i decided to terminate the pregnancy. it was not a difficult decision at all, and i was very lucky to have the support of my partner, doctors, and community. i am eternally grateful to planned parenthood for helping me navigate my options, and for the women’s health center nearby where i had the abortion. now that we are both out of school and on stable financial ground, my husband and i look forward to starting a family.
